If your post is deleted then you should get private message which describes the reason why the post is deleted, so check your PM. In case that whole thread is deleted, and you post in such thread, then you will not get any message.

You also have option to contact moderato/s of each board and ask them via PM why your post is deleted, but keep in mind that some boards do not have moderator, and they are moderated by global mods.

theymos emphasizes about off-topic there:
Off-topic replies have become a big problem. From now on, I will be deleting such replies without notice, forum-wide. If your replies disappear, this is probably why.

All replies must respond to the topic's original post in some way, even if they are replying to an on-topic reply. If your reply has nothing to do with the topic post, either add some content that is relevant or create a new topic.

Please report off-topic posts as soon as you see them.
